The fractions that have the same denominators are like fractions. They can also be defined as fractions with the same bottom numbers.For example, 11/20, 13/20, 27/20 1/20... These are all like fraction. 

We can also convert unlike fraction to like fraction by simply writting them with denominators been their LCM.
